I was thinking maybe we should come up with some other places that might be considered "pre-show support" so we don't miss anything. I still think it's most likely going to be a slide or something in the theater itself, but just in case...

So, in addition to the ads and music inside the actual theater, how about checking:
o Your ticket stub (some theaters around here have ads on the back of the stub, or little blurbs on the front about upcoming movies)
o All the movie posters in the lobby, outside, etc
o Talk to all the workers in the theater and ask them if they know anything about The Receda Approach
o Check any scrolling marquis type signs to make sure there's nothing in them
o The bathrooms... Who knows Smile

That's all of my ideas... I wonder how long this "pre-show support" thing is going to go on for. It doesn't have an end date listed, just a begin date.

Saw something

Hey there - I haven't been around for a while (sorry). I was at the movies up in Richmond Hill last night. Before the movie started there was an ad with dark colours, flickering images - wasn't really paying attention until the end. Saw something that said receda sign (and well, how often does the word receda pop up in normal english?)- just checked www.therecedasign.com now and it looks like a PC website. Hmmmm....

Anyone else going see this? It was pretty short, you'll have to be paying attention to notice it.
